#2d9430 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d9430 is composed of 17.6% red, 58%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.6%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 121.7 degrees, a saturation of 53.4% and a lightness of 37.8%. #2d9430 color hex could be obtained by blending #5aff60 with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#2d9430 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#2d9430 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2d9430 has RGB values of R:45, G:148,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0, Y:0.68,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 2987056.
